Web26 mei 2024 · Prepare the Plant for Extraction. Lightly water the plant, let it dry for an hour or so, and then gently remove the plant from the pot. You can do this by turning the pot over and gently pulling the pot up and away from the root ball. It is not a good idea to yank a plant out of its pot by the stem. Web30 jun. 2013 · Plan to repot a young fiddle-leaf fig annually every spring. Select a sturdy container that is roughly 2 inches larger in diameter than the existing one. Gently loosen the plant from its current pot, lift it out while supporting its base, and place it in the new pot.

Web31 dec. 2024 · The best time of the year to propagate your Ficus is during the summer when the plant is actively growing. The best way to get new Weeping figs is by taking stem cuttings. Look for stems with at least two sets of leaves, then use sharp scissors or pruning shears to make a clean cut below the bottom set of leaves. Web9 dec. 2024 · You should repot a fiddle leaf fig plant only when it has outgrown its current pot. Web1 jan. 2024 · Fiddle Leaf fig trees thrive in slightly acidic soil with a pH of 6-7. Soil pH is often overlooked but can affect a plant’s ability to absorb nutrients from the soil. This can show up as yellowing leaves and eventually kill your plants! Make sure to test the pH of your soil regularly with a 3-in-1 moisture meter for the best results. Web23 feb. 2024 · Have saucers and a Reservoir. Fiddle Leaf Fig Tree requires pot sizes that are 3 – 4 inches wider in diameter and 3 inches in height to accommodate the roots of the plant. Don’t use large pots as they might result in root rot as a result of too much water clogged in the soil.

Web19 jul. 2024 · Upon purchase, do not wait to repot your fiddle leaf fig. Step One) Remove the plant from its nursery container and gently remove as much soil from the roots as you possibly can. You can use water to help dislodge some of the soil bits. Clean off as much of the nursery soil as you possibly can.

Repot your fig tree during the winter. To repot your tree, remove about one-quarter of the soil in the pot. Then, pull your fig tree up out of the pot and cut away the large roots on the outside of the clump of roots.
